Which blue? The '05 Indigo Ink Pearl color, or the '06+ Nautical blue? A lot of people like gold or bronze wheels with blue. I personally don't. For me, black wheels with a polished or machined lip on NB looks GREAT (That's what i roll with).
If that's too dark for you, go with silver, gunmetal, or hyper dark.

I actually like the way blue and gold/bronze look together.
and yea under certain lighting conditions IIP and NBM look very different. NBM stays dark where IIP would go very light.
I for one didn't much enjoy black rims on a dark blue car. i went with silver.
